Material Costs - The cost of materials for barn construction typically ranges from $10,000 to $30,000 depending on size and quality. For example, a standard 24x36-foot barn may use materials costing around $15,000. Variations depend on wood, metal, and finishing choices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s usually fall between $5,000 and $20,000, influenced by the project's complexity and local rates. A basic barn might require around $8,000 for labor, while larger or custom designs can increase expenses.
Size and Design - Larger barns or those with complex designs tend to cost more, with prices potentially exceeding $50,000. Smaller, straightforward structures may stay within the $10,000 to $25,000 range.
Additional Features - Adding features like insulation, windows, or custom doors can add $2,000 to $10,000 to the overall cost. The inclusion of these extras depends on the specific requirements and preferences of the project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
